Functional nutrient-genetic profiling reveals biotin and FBXW7 are essential to bypass glutamine addiction Lisci et al. present a unified model revealing how cells escape glutamine addiction, a metabolic vulnerability of several cancers. Combining systematic genetic and nutrient screens, they show that bio...

Polyamine-dependent metabolic shielding regulates alternative splicing - Nature Polyamines prevent the action of kinases on acidic phosphorylatable motifs in spliceosomal proteins, thus providing a mechanism for metabolite-mediated regulation of alternative splicing in cells.
